Following the continued growth and success of Linesight we are expanding the European HR team & seeking a HR Business Partner (HRBP).
The role will serve as a strategic partner to business leaders, aligning HR practices and initiatives with organizational goals. The HRBP will provide expert HR guidance and support in areas such as talent management, employee relations, performance management, and organizational development.
We are looking for a dynamic, business focused HR professional who brings with them a passion for driving value led growth and partnering for success.
Reporting to the HR Leader for the region, this role will be a key member of the global HR team
